The AP1507-50D5L-13 is a high-performance step-down (buck) converter offered by Diodes Incorporated, a leading global manufacturer and supplier of high-quality application-specific standard products within the broad discrete, logic, analog, and mixed-signal semiconductor markets. This particular component is designed to convert higher voltage levels to a lower voltage, providing an efficient power management solution for a wide range of applications.
Key Features
- Output Voltage: The device provides a fixed output voltage of 5V, which is a common requirement for digital circuits and microcontroller-based systems.
- High Efficiency: With its advanced design, the AP1507-50D5L-13 achieves high efficiency, which minimizes energy loss during the voltage conversion process and helps in reducing heat generation.
- Adjustable Switching Frequency: The switching frequency of the AP1507 can be programmed up to 150kHz, allowing designers to balance between efficiency and component size.
- Output Current: It is capable of delivering up to 3A of continuous output current, making it suitable for powering a wide array of devices.
- Thermal Protection: The device includes built-in thermal protection that shuts down the output when the junction temperature exceeds the thermal shutdown threshold, thereby ensuring safe operation under various conditions.
- Low Dropout Operation: It is optimized for low dropout performance, which ensures stable output even when the input-to-output voltage differential is small.

Package and Availability
This buck converter is available in a TO-252-5L package, which is designed for surface mount technology (SMT). The package is compact and suitable for automated assembly processes, contributing to the ease of manufacturing.
